Getting Started with Composting

Composting at home is an environmentally friendly practice that transforms organic waste into nutrient-rich compost for gardening and landscaping. To embark on this sustainable journey, the first step is selecting the appropriate compost bin. Compost bins come in various types, including traditional bins, compost tumblers, and worm composters (vermicomposting). Each type has its advantages, so choosing one that aligns with your available space and the volume of kitchen waste is crucial. A well-ventilated bin encourages aeration, speeding up the decomposition process.

Location is another important factor when starting your composting project. Ideally, the compost bin should be situated in a dry, shaded area with good drainage. It should also be easily accessible, allowing for the addition of kitchen scraps and yard waste, as well as for regular mixing and harvesting. Ensuring proper air circulation around the compost will help maintain manageable moisture levels and promote effective decomposition.

Understanding the basics of compost materials is essential for producing high-quality compost. A successful compost pile requires a balanced mix of ‘greens’ (nitrogen-rich materials) and ‘browns’ (carbon-rich materials). Greens include kitchen scraps such as vegetable peels, fruit waste, and coffee grounds. Browns consist of dry leaves, twigs, cardboard, and paper products. Striking the right balance is vital; a good rule of thumb is to aim for a ratio of about three parts browns to one part greens. This balance will facilitate optimal microbial activity, ensuring that the composting process is efficient.

What to Compost: A Comprehensive Guide

Composting at home offers a sustainable way to manage waste while enriching soil. To initiate this eco-friendly process, it is essential to understand what materials are suitable for composting. Generally, compostable materials can be categorized into kitchen scraps, yard waste, and two essential types: green and brown materials.

Kitchen scraps are excellent compost ingredients. These include fruit and vegetable peels, coffee grounds, eggshells, and stale bread. It is advisable to avoid meat, dairy, and oily foods as they can attract pests and create unpleasant odors. Additionally, leftover grains and nuts can be composted, but moderation is key to prevent attracting unwanted animals.

Yard waste is another significant contributor to home composting systems. Grass clippings, leaves, branches, and plant trimmings are rich in nutrients and add volume to the compost pile. These materials can enhance aeration and facilitate decomposition. However, it is best to avoid diseased plants or weeds with seeds to prevent potential contamination in the finished compost.

Compostable materials are further classified into green and brown categories. Green materials, rich in nitrogen, include fresh grass clippings, vegetable scraps, and coffee grounds. They help in the decomposition process by stimulating microbial growth. On the other hand, brown materials provide carbon and comprise items like dried leaves, twigs, and shredded paper. A healthy composting ratio typically involves mixing one part green to three parts brown materials.

While many materials can be composted, certain items should be kept out of the compost bin. Items such as pet waste, processed foods, and glossy paper can complicate the decomposition process or introduce harmful pathogens. Maintaining Your Compost Pile

Maintaining a healthy compost pile is crucial for successful composting. An efficient composting process relies on proper aeration, moisture levels, and a balanced mix of organic materials. One of the primary maintenance tasks is turning the compost. This process aerates the pile and accelerates decomposition, ensuring that all materials break down evenly. It is advisable to turn the compost every few weeks, using a pitchfork or shovel to mix the top layers with those at the bottom, exposing less decomposed materials to oxygen and warmth.

Another essential aspect of compost maintenance is monitoring moisture levels. A compost pile should maintain an appropriate level of moisture—ideally, it should feel like a damp sponge. If the compost is too dry, decomposition slows down. In this case, water should be added gradually until the desired moisture level is achieved. Conversely, if the pile is too wet, it may become compacted and anaerobic, leading to unpleasant odors. To remedy this, one can add dry materials, such as shredded leaves or cardboard, to absorb excess moisture. Additionally, increasing aeration through turning the pile can help alleviate dampness.

Common issues can arise during the composting process, such as foul odors, excessive heat, or the presence of pests. Foul odors often indicate an anaerobic environment resulting from a lack of oxygen or an imbalance of green and brown materials. Addressing this involves turning the compost and adjusting the carbon-to-nitrogen ratio by adding more brown materials. Excessive heat may signal an overly compacted pile, which can be remedied by turning it more frequently. Lastly, if pests appear, it is essential to ensure that the compost is covered and that only permitted kitchen scraps are included, as this will deter unwanted visitors. Using Your Finished Compost

Once you have successfully created finished compost, the next step is to incorporate it into your gardening practices effectively. Finished compost is a valuable resource that can significantly improve your garden’s health and sustainability. There are several effective applications for utilizing your homemade compost, each tailored to enhance soil quality and promote plant growth.

One of the primary uses of finished compost is as a soil amendment. By blending compost into the existing soil, you enrich it with essential nutrients, beneficial microorganisms, and organic matter. This not only improves soil structure but also enhances its ability to retain moisture, thus benefiting plant roots. Ideally, you should incorporate compost into the top layer of soil before planting new seeds or transplants, ensuring that the nutrients are readily available to young plants.

Another effective application is using compost as mulch. When spread evenly over the soil surface, compost works as a protective layer that retains moisture, suppresses weed growth, and provides a steady release of nutrients as it breaks down. This technique helps maintain a stable soil temperature, which is crucial for optimal plant growth. It is advisable to apply a layer of compost mulch about two to three inches thick around the base of plants, avoiding direct contact with the stems to protect against rot.

Furthermore, finished compost is an excellent addition to potting mixes for container gardening. Blending compost with potting soil provides plants with a rich nutrient base and improved aeration. It can be used in various containers, from small pots for herbs to larger planters for flowering plants. Composting in Small Spaces

Composting is a remarkable way to manage organic waste and contribute to environmental sustainability, and it can be practiced even in small living spaces such as apartments or homes with limited yards. Various composting methods have been developed to accommodate those with restricted environments while ensuring effective waste decomposition.

One popular option for urban dwellers is vermicomposting, which utilizes earthworms to break down kitchen scraps into nutrient-rich compost. This method is particularly suitable for limited spaces as it can be performed in a bin that fits neatly under the sink or in a closet. By using a worm bin, individuals can compost fruit and vegetable peels, coffee grounds, and small amounts of paper. Additionally, vermicomposting promotes a clean and odorless process, making it ideal for indoor use. Regular maintenance involves feeding the worms and ensuring the bin remains moist but not overly wet, which can be easily managed in a small setting.

Another innovative approach is bokashi composting, a fermentation-based method that also works well in confined spaces. This technique involves layering kitchen waste in a specially designed bin with bokashi bran, which contains beneficial microbes. The anaerobic fermentation process breaks down organic matter in just a couple of weeks. Once the fermentation is complete, the byproduct can be buried in soil or added to traditional compost piles, enriching them with vital nutrients. Bokashi is ideal for composting meats and dairy, which are typically not recommended for other methods.

Community Composting Initiatives

As society increasingly recognizes the importance of sustainability, community composting initiatives have emerged as a vital part of the movement towards reducing waste and enhancing environmental responsibility. These programs often operate through partnerships between local governments, non-profit organizations, and residents, encouraging community members to engage in composting practices collectively. Such initiatives not only divert organic waste from landfills but also enrich local soil and promote biodiversity in urban settings.

Several successful community composting programs have been implemented across various cities, showcasing strategies that can be tailored to meet the specific needs of each locality. For instance, in Portland, Oregon, the Bureau of Planning and Sustainability provides residents with resources and workshops to establish neighborhood composting sites. Similarly, in San Francisco, the city promotes community compost hubs that serve as drop-off points for organic waste, significantly reducing landfill contributions.
